TL;DR When doing instant flash I get the message about "press enter, PC will reboot and BIOS will continue to flash". All that happens is PC restarts and boots normally and goes all the way to windows.

Full version:

While I saw the suggestion about "don't upgrade BIOS if everything is already working correctly", I'm way back on 2.0 (March 2018) and just felt like updating for something to do.

I've been trying to do Instant Flash with a FAT 32 usb drive. I tried to jump right up to 4.20. I get a message "Instant Flash - after pressing <enter>, the system will automatically reboot. Please wait fora few seconds and the BIOS update will continue".

I get an immediate hard shutdown if I hit enter or press OK. The PC restarts, loads as normal, and goes all the way to Windows. Nothing ever updates, BIOS version stays the same.

I saw a comment online about not jumping directly to 4.20, 3.30 is the last update before the yellow text warning about "you won't be able to revert to older BIOS from here", so I thought okay, maybe I need to get to 3.30 first.

Just tried that, same thing. I get that message about pressing enter, I press it, PC shuts down, turns back on, I get the usual ASRock boot screens and it goes to Windows.
